Transaction 5f51386ce57ca69663e92aec032f3cb4b427b596000a3b4f01d90df5179bf641
1 Input
1 Output
-
5f51386ce57ca69663e92aec032f3cb4b427b596000a3b4f01d90df5179bf641:0
- value
- 102740062
- script pubkey
- OP_0 OP_PUSHBYTES_20 de17968d87ceace7535c2f48b9fe575137313143
- address
- bc1qmctedrv8e6kww56u9aytnljh2ymnzv2rq30c87